Package io.fabric8.openshift.api.model
Class RouteSpecBuilder
- java.lang.Object
-
- io.fabric8.kubernetes.api.builder.BaseFluent<A>
-
- io.fabric8.openshift.api.model.RouteSpecFluent<RouteSpecBuilder>
-
- io.fabric8.openshift.api.model.RouteSpecBuilder
-
- All Implemented Interfaces:
io.fabric8.kubernetes.api.builder.Builder<RouteSpec>,io.fabric8.kubernetes.api.builder.Visitable<RouteSpecBuilder>,io.fabric8.kubernetes.api.builder.VisitableBuilder<RouteSpec,RouteSpecBuilder>
public class RouteSpecBuilder extends RouteSpecFluent<RouteSpecBuilder> implements io.fabric8.kubernetes.api.builder.VisitableBuilder<RouteSpec,RouteSpecBuilder>
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class io.fabric8.openshift.api.model.RouteSpecFluent
RouteSpecFluent.AlternateBackendsNested<N>, RouteSpecFluent.HttpHeadersNested<N>, RouteSpecFluent.PortNested<N>, RouteSpecFluent.TlsNested<N>, RouteSpecFluent.ToNested<N>
-
-
Constructor Summary
Constructors Constructor Description RouteSpecBuilder()RouteSpecBuilder(RouteSpec instance)RouteSpecBuilder(RouteSpecFluent<?> fluent)RouteSpecBuilder(RouteSpecFluent<?> fluent, RouteSpec instance)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description RouteSpecbuild()-
Methods inherited from class io.fabric8.openshift.api.model.RouteSpecFluent
addAllToAlternateBackends, addNewAlternateBackend, addNewAlternateBackend, addNewAlternateBackendLike, addToAdditionalProperties, addToAdditionalProperties, addToAlternateBackends, addToAlternateBackends, buildAlternateBackend, buildAlternateBackends, buildFirstAlternateBackend, buildHttpHeaders, buildLastAlternateBackend, buildMatchingAlternateBackend, buildPort, buildTls, buildTo, copyInstance, editAlternateBackend, editFirstAlternateBackend, editHttpHeaders, editLastAlternateBackend, editMatchingAlternateBackend, editOrNewHttpHeaders, editOrNewHttpHeadersLike, editOrNewPort, editOrNewPortLike, editOrNewTls, editOrNewTlsLike, editOrNewTo, editOrNewToLike, editPort, editTls, editTo, equals, getAdditionalProperties, getHost, getPath, getSubdomain, getWildcardPolicy, hasAdditionalProperties, hasAlternateBackends, hashCode, hasHost, hasHttpHeaders, hasMatchingAlternateBackend, hasPath, hasPort, hasSubdomain, hasTls, hasTo, hasWildcardPolicy, removeAllFromAlternateBackends, removeFromAdditionalProperties, removeFromAdditionalProperties, removeFromAlternateBackends, removeMatchingFromAlternateBackends, setNewAlternateBackendLike, setToAlternateBackends, toString, withAdditionalProperties, withAlternateBackends, withAlternateBackends, withHost, withHttpHeaders, withNewHttpHeaders, withNewHttpHeadersLike, withNewPort, withNewPortLike, withNewTls, withNewTlsLike, withNewTo, withNewTo, withNewToLike, withPath, withPort, withSubdomain, withTls, withTo, withWildcardPolicy
-
Methods inherited from class io.fabric8.kubernetes.api.builder.BaseFluent
aggregate, aggregate, build, build, builderOf, getVisitableMap
-
-
-
-
Constructor Detail
-
RouteSpecBuilder
public RouteSpecBuilder()
-
RouteSpecBuilder
public RouteSpecBuilder(RouteSpecFluent<?> fluent)
-
RouteSpecBuilder
public RouteSpecBuilder(RouteSpec instance)
-
RouteSpecBuilder
public RouteSpecBuilder(RouteSpecFluent<?> fluent, RouteSpec instance)
-
-